What this record shows
This record is dominated by speaking fees: $94,000 of the $143,537 with a category attached, or 65.5%. Kerecis Limited accounts for 83.1% of it on its own, with 6 other manufacturers making up the rest. Among surgery clinicians in AZ with any reported payments, this total sits in the top 5% — high for the specialty, which is a reason to read the composition above rather than the number alone.

Medicare billing
What this is not: this is the amount Original Medicare Part B allowed for services this provider billed in 2024. It is not their income. It excludes Medicare Advantage — now more than half of all Medicare enrollment — along with Medicaid and all commercial insurance, and it is gross practice revenue before staff, rent, supplies and malpractice premiums. CMS also suppresses any figure covering ten or fewer patients, so low-volume providers appear smaller than they are.
